So I apologize if this has been dealt with before. But is it possible to use two OBD2 devices simultaneously? I've read on the internet certain vehicles can depending on what info is being requested, or if they aren't trying to use the same pins or data at the same time. I know the internet is full of misinformation so I figured I'd ask here instead.

What I'm trying to see is if I can permanently mount my nGauge and have it plugged into my obd2 port, but use a splitter so I can simultaneously have a Bluetooth obd2 dongle for torque use. The other question is if people are able to use both the nGauge and an insurance policy tracking dongle such as the snapshot simultaneously. (Don't ask me why someone with a tune would think it's a good idea to use a device that lets their insurance company know of their driving habits though lol, just wondering if it's possible)
